INFLUENZA

cases; in the dominion,

TTt*r;* As!=oci«fcion.. CHRISTOHURCH, May 13

The Hon. G. W. Russell to-night supplied the following influenza figures for the period from Bth to 12th of May. The total for the Dominion was 54 cases, made up as follows: — Auckland district 17 cases, of which four in Auckland city are &evere and also one in Whakatane. Wellington district 12 cases, of which two at Waipawa are severe and one in Wellington city. Nelsoin district three (all mild). North Canterbury 14 mild and threej pneumonic. South Canterbury four mild and two severe. West Coast and Buller hospital district two mild. Otago two mild and one severe.
